Stegra, a Swedish company based in Boden, Northern Sweden, is leading a remarkable initiative to revolutionize steel production by decarbonizing the process using green hydrogen. The company is set to start steel production by 2026 after dispatching 740 MW electrolyzers to the site. The traditional steel production process has a severe environmental impact, with estimates suggesting that every ton of steel produced results in 1.9 tons of carbon emissions. Stegra's approach involves integrating green hydrogen into the direct reduction process to significantly reduce carbon emissions, ultimately aiming to produce green steel with minimal environmental footprint. Founded in 2020, Stegra is focused on decarbonizing industries that heavily rely on fossil fuels, starting with steel production. By replacing coal with renewable hydrogen, Stegra is paving the way for a more sustainable steel industry. The company's order of 37 alkaline electrolysis modules, each with a 20 MW rating, from Thyssenkrupp signifies a significant step towards achieving their green steel production goal. The installation of the electrolyzers in Boden signifies a milestone for Stegra, positioning them as a global leader in green hydrogen-powered steel production. The involvement of a large workforce of 3,000 individuals in the project highlights the scale and importance of this green initiative. By 2026, Stegra aims to roll out its first green steel, showcasing a tangible outcome of their commitment to sustainability.
